Evolution of Salesforce

Salesforce's evolution is a testament to its adaptability and innovation in the ever-changing landscape of technology and business. Founded in 1999, Salesforce pioneered the concept of delivering CRM software via the cloud, challenging the traditional on-premise software model. Over the years, Salesforce has continually expanded its product offerings beyond core CRM functionalities to encompass sales automation, marketing automation, customer service, analytics, and more.

One of the key milestones in Salesforce's evolution was the introduction of the Salesforce Customer Success Platform, which integrated various cloud services into a unified platform, providing a holistic view of customer interactions and data. Subsequent acquisitions, such as those of ExactTarget, Pardot, and Tableau, further enriched Salesforce's capabilities, enabling businesses to leverage advanced analytics, AI-driven insights, and omnichannel marketing automation.

Furthermore, Salesforce's commitment to innovation is evident through its regular updates and releases, introducing features like Lightning Experience, Einstein AI, and Industry Clouds tailored to specific verticals. As Salesforce continues to evolve, it remains at the forefront of driving digital transformation and empowering businesses to connect with their customers in meaningful ways.

Versatility and Customization

Salesforce's versatility and customization capabilities are unparalleled, allowing businesses to tailor the platform to suit their unique processes and requirements. At the core of Salesforce's customization capabilities is the Lightning Platform, a powerful suite of tools that enables users to build custom applications, workflows, and data models without writing extensive code.

With point-and-click customization features such as App Builder, Process Builder, and Flow Builder, users can easily create custom objects, fields, layouts, and automation rules to mirror their business processes within Salesforce. Additionally, Salesforce's robust security model ensures that customizations are implemented in a secure and compliant manner, safeguarding sensitive data and preventing unauthorized access.

Furthermore, Salesforce offers a vast ecosystem of third-party apps and integrations through the Salesforce AppExchange marketplace, providing additional layers of customization and extending the platform's functionality. Whether it's industry-specific solutions, productivity tools, or integration with external systems, businesses have access to a plethora of options to enhance their Salesforce experience and drive business outcomes.

Robust Integration Capabilities

Seamless integration with other systems and applications is essential for maximizing the value of a CRM platform, and Salesforce offers robust integration capabilities to facilitate interoperability with a wide range of third-party solutions. Whether it's integrating with ERP systems, marketing automation platforms, e-commerce platforms, or productivity tools, Salesforce provides multiple integration options to suit different use cases and requirements.

One of the key integration capabilities offered by Salesforce is its REST and SOAP APIs, which allow developers to programmatically access and manipulate Salesforce data and functionality from external systems. This enables real-time data synchronization, automated workflows, and seamless data exchange between Salesforce and other business applications.

In addition to APIs, Salesforce offers pre-built connectors and middleware solutions for popular third-party applications, simplifying the integration process and reducing time-to-market. Moreover, Salesforce's AppExchange marketplace features thousands of third-party apps and add-ons that extend the platform's functionality and provide out-of-the-box integrations with leading software solutions across various categories.

Data Security and Compliance

Data security and compliance are top priorities for businesses entrusted with sensitive customer information, and Salesforce places a strong emphasis on protecting user data against unauthorized access, breaches, and cyber threats. With a comprehensive suite of security features and compliance certifications, Salesforce provides robust safeguards to 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of customer data.

One of the key pillars of Salesforce's data security strategy is encryption, which is used to protect data both at rest and in transit. Salesforce employs industry-standard encryption algorithms to encrypt data stored in its databases, as well as data transmitted between users and the Salesforce platform, ensuring that sensitive information remains secure from unauthorized access or interception.

Additionally, Salesforce offers a range of access controls and authentication mechanisms to enforce granular permissions and ensure that only authorized users have access to sensitive data and functionalities. Whether it's role-based access control, object-level security, or field-level security, Salesforce provides flexible options to tailor access controls to the specific needs of each organization and user role.

In terms of compliance, Salesforce adheres to global privacy regulations such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A), as well as industry-specific standards such as HIPAA for healthcare data. By implementing rigorous security measures, undergoing regular audits and certifications, and providing transparency and control over data handling practices, Salesforce enables businesses to confidently leverage its platform for managing customer relationships while maintaining compliance with applicable regulations.

Exceptional User Experience

Salesforce prioritizes user experience as a cornerstone of its platform, striving to deliver an intuitive, seamless, and personalized interface that enhances productivity, engagement, and satisfaction for users across all roles and industries. With its modern design, intuitive navigation, and responsive layouts, Salesforce provides a user-friendly experience that makes it easy for users to access information, perform tasks, and collaborate with colleagues.

One of the key elements of Salesforce's user experience is the Lightning Experience, a modern and responsive user interface that offers a streamlined and visually appealing environment for interacting with CRM data and functionalities. With features such as customizable dashboards, Kanban boards, and dynamic page layouts, Lightning Experience enables users to personalize their workspace and focus on the most relevant information and tasks.

Furthermore, Salesforce's mobile apps extend the CRM experience beyond the desktop, allowing users to access Salesforce data and functionalities on-the-go from their smartphones and tablets. Whether it's checking sales opportunities, responding to customer inquiries, or updating records, users can stay connected and productive anytime, anywhere, with the Salesforce mobile app.

In addition to its intuitive interface and mobile capabilities, Salesforce offers personalized recommendations and insights powered by artificial intelligence (AI) through its Einstein AI platform. By analyzing vast amounts of data and identifying patterns and trends, Einstein AI helps users make data-driven decisions, prioritize tasks, and uncover opportunities for growth and optimization.

Strong Community Support

Salesforce boasts a vibrant and passionate community of users, administrators, developers, and partners who actively contribute to its ecosystem through knowledge sharing, collaboration, and support. Whether it's online forums, community groups, or local meetups, Salesforce's community provides invaluable resources, guidance, and networking opportunities for users at all levels of expertise.

One of the key benefits of Salesforce's community support is the wealth of online forums and discussion boards where users can ask questions, share best practices, and troubleshoot issues with fellow community members. Platforms such as the Salesforce Success Community, Stack Exchange, and Reddit's r/salesforce offer a wealth of knowledge and expertise on topics ranging from configuration and customization to development and integration.

In addition to online forums, Salesforce hosts a variety of community events and gatherings, including local user groups, community-led conferences, and the annual Dreamforce conference. These events provide opportunities for users to connect with peers, learn from industry experts, and gain insights into the latest trends and innovations in the Salesforce ecosystem.

Moreover, Salesforce's Trailblazer Community platform offers interactive learning modules, guided trails, and certification preparation resources to help users expand their skills and advance their careers in the Salesforce ecosystem. Whether it's earning a Salesforce certification, mastering a specific Salesforce product, or exploring new career opportunities, the Trailblazer Community provides a supportive environment for continuous learning and growth.

Continuous Innovation and Updates

Innovation is at the core of Salesforce's DNA, with the company continuously striving to enhance its platform with new features, capabilities, and enhancements that empower businesses to drive growth, increase efficiency, and deliver exceptional customer experiences. Through regular updates and releases, Salesforce introduces innovations that leverage emerging technologies such as art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ning (ML), and the Internet of Things (IoT) to address evolving market needs and challenges.

One of the key drivers of Salesforce's innovation is its commitment to customer feedback and co-innovation, actively soliciting input from users and stakeholders to prioritize feature development and enhancements. Through programs such as the IdeaExchange, customers can submit ideas, vote on proposed features, and collaborate with Salesforce product teams to shape the future direction of the platform.

Furthermore, Salesforce invests heavily in research and development, acquiring cutting-edge technology companies and integrating their capabilities into the Salesforce platform to deliver new and differentiated solutions to customers. Recent acquisitions, such as those of Tableau for data analytics and MuleSoft for integration, have expanded Salesforce's product portfolio and enriched its offerings with best-in-class technologies.

Moreover, Salesforce's agile development methodology enables rapid iteration and experimentation, allowing the company to quickly respond to market feedback and emerging trends. By releasing updates and features on a regular basis, Salesforce ensures that users always have access to the latest innovations and enhancements, driving continuous value and differentiation for businesses leveraging the platform.
